About the Role
This role leads our work on strengthening and embedding quality assurance across Refuge services. You will obtain external accreditations, refresh internal audit processes, and oversee the development and review of operational policies. You’ll work across teams and with survivors to ensure services reflect best practice, legal compliance, and feminist values.
Responsibilities
- Obtain and maintain external accreditations for Refuge services.
- Refresh internal audit processes and develop audit schedules.
- Oversee the development, implementation, and review of operational policies.
- Collaborate with teams and survivors to embed best practice, legal compliance, and feminist values across services.
- Lead quality improvement initiatives and report on performance to senior leadership.
